## Pagination quick notes

Hey! The Quillbird public API paginates everything with cursor tokens — no page numbers, ever. Clients pass `cursor` and `limit` (max 200). Release builds must point PAGINATION_MODE at "cursor" or smoke tests fail. One more thing before you cut a release: the staging gateway needs an auth secret in the env file, which goes on the next line.

vault entry, yahif-yajep: COURIER_KEY29=b802bdf8034096b65a51c6ba5abe2

Build provenance: Digest Scheduler (Lanternmail). Every deploy of the batch email digest scheduler is built in the sealed pipeline and signed before promotion; unsigned artifacts must never be rolled out, even during an incident. When paged for digest delays, first confirm the running artifact matches the attested release record. The currently attested provenance token is recorded below.

trace token, bagug-yahof: htk21_2d0de668956bdbfbe66bf

Subject: Quickstore 4.2 — bloom filter now fronts the KV layer

Plugin authors: starting with this release, Quickstore places a bloom filter ahead of the key-value store. Negative lookups return faster; false positives fall through safely. No API changes are required on your side. Verify your plugin against the staging build referenced below.

session token of fahif-tadup = htk3_9c7

## Releases

Welcome aboard! Quieten, our on-call alert deduplicator, ships every other Thursday. We cut a tag from main, run the smoke suite against the Farwick staging cluster, and push artifacts to the internal registry. If you're doing the release, ping whoever's on rotation first — usually Marla or Deet — so nobody double-cuts. Hotfixes skip the schedule but still need a signed build; unsigned tarballs get rejected at deploy time, no exceptions. To verify any release artifact locally, use the current signing key below.

signing key of yagug-bawif = bky9_cvCf6ehGp